Has anyone had an issue where the deflector prevented the hood from closing??? My 2015 TE doesn't have the clearance for a Weather Tech deflector.....

Yeah, my AVS deflector makes it a bit hard to close the hood, I have to drop it from about 12 inches up to get it to lock. If I close it and try to push it closed, I'll end up with a huge dent in the hood!

Its the screw heads touching the plastic shroud in the closed position. I haven't decided what I want to do just yet, I may either grind the heads of the screws down, or put a relief hole where each head is touching the shroud. Its just barely touching it right now, as I can just see a slight rubbing of the 2 outermost screws in the shroud, so I'm not too worried about it just yet. I rarely open the hood, so it hasn't been a major issue.
